Industrial Painting in Syracuse

Industrial painting is a specialized service that goes far beyond a simple coat of paint. It involves the preparation, priming, and application of high-performance coatings to large-scale structures such as warehouses, manufacturing facilities, storage tanks, commercial garages, and industrial machinery. In Syracuse, where heavy industry and manufacturing have long been a part of the city’s economy, these structures face unique challenges: harsh winters, salt exposure from roads, moisture from the nearby Onondaga Lake and Erie Canal, and the constant wear of machinery and forklifts.

The process begins with a thorough inspection of the surface. Steel beams may need abrasive blasting to remove rust and old paint, while concrete floors require etching and patching to create a clean, adhesive-ready surface. For metal surfaces, we often apply a rust-inhibitive primer followed by a durable topcoat that resists chemicals, UV rays, and abrasion. For interior industrial spaces, we use epoxy or polyurethane coatings that can withstand heavy foot traffic, spills, and frequent cleaning. Every step is done with attention to safety, including proper ventilation, containment of debris, and use of low-VOC or zero-VOC paints where possible.
